Talking to some others who are more skilled than me, they suspect that the smoke from the air intake was just unburned fuel from when it backfired in the throttlebody. They recommended spraying some throttle body cleaner (is that the smae as carb cleaner?) inside and letting it evaporate just to be sure.
I've also found threads where people have similiar symptoms stemming from a cracked ECM from the seat being on it and water getting inside. So I'm going to check that too. If none of that works, I'll be getting a cable and downloading ECMspy to try a TPS reset. After that, the stealership is my final option.
